

Run & Reflect
Run and reflect with us to help make running in Amsterdam safer for all!
On 26 February, we’re hosting an evening focused on running safety in collaboration with All4Running.
The session includes guided runs that combine movement with reflection, inviting runners to actively explore how the running environment feels, from lighting and visibility to social safety and overall comfort.
Participants will run together on one of two pre-selected routes (5–7 km), share their experiences, and take part in a facilitated discussion about safety, perception, and inclusivity in public running spaces. The insights gathered will contribute to broader efforts to improve the running environment in Amsterdam.
Your input helps shape improvements to local running routes and contributes to a citywide safer-running map.
What to expect:
Welcome, briefing & bag drop
Guided group run on one of two routes (5 km) through Vondelpark & Rembrandtpark
Short, facilitated reflection moments during and after the run
Post-run feedback and group discussion
Opportunity to test GATO light vests during the run
Snacks and drinks provided
Both routes are suitable for an easy, conversational pace. This session is not about speed or performance, it’s about observation, shared experience, and working together to make running safer and more inclusive for everyone.
